Designation:D732907(Reapproved 2012)Standard Specification forFood Preparation and Food Handling(Food Service)Gloves1This standard is issued under the fixed designation D7329;the number immediately following the designation indicates the year oforiginal adoption or,in the case of revision,the year of last revision.A number in parentheses indicates the year of last reapproval.Asuperscript epsilon()indicates an editorial change since the last revision or reapproval.1.Scope1.1 This specification covers the properties necessary forthin film,unlined polymer gloves to be used in food prepara-tion and food handling.1.2 This specification is intended to serve as a referee and aguide to permit obtaining gloves of a consistent performance.The safe and proper use of gloves is excluded from the scopeof this specification.1.3 This standard does not purport to address all of thesafety concerns,if any,associated with its use.It is theresponsibility of the user of this standard to Inspectionby Attributes32.3 Code of Federal RegulationsTitle 21Food andDrugs:21 CFR Parts 17019943.Materials and Manufacture3.1 Any material or composition that permits the glove tomeet the specification identified by this standard and complywith the requirements of this specification and the regulationspromulgated by the U.S.Food and Drug Administrationconcerning the materials used and permitted for direct foodcontact and the regulations concerning any powder or lubri-cants added to the gloves are acceptable.4.Performance Requirements4.1 Gloves shall be sampled in accordance with the AQLspecified in Table 1 using a sampling plan derived from ISO2859-1 or its equivalent,or other suitable statistical rationale.4.2 Gloves shall be tested for freedom of holes as describedin 5.1 and comply with the requirements of Table 1 for freedomfrom holes.4.3 Gloves shall meet and be tested for dimensions andtolerances as described in 5.2 and comply with the perfor-mance requirements listed in Table 1 for dimensions.4.4 Gloves shall meet and be tested for physical propertiesas described in 5.3 and comply with the performance require-ments listed in Table 1 for physical
